当你遇到“TPWallet找不到”的情况,往往不是单一问题,而是由接入方式、网络条件、合约交互、权限与安全策略共同作用的结果。下面给出全方位分析框架:既覆盖排查路径,也从安全(防代码注入、密码保密)、技术架构(轻节点)、以及更宏观的行业趋势(全球化数字化、行业动向预测、数据化商业模式)进行联动解释。
一、先做结论导向的故障分层:从“找不到”到“能找到”
1)定位“找不到”的含义
- 是应用商店搜不到?
- 是客户端无法打开/白屏?
- 是钱包地址或代币列表不显示?
- 是导入/恢复后账户余额为空?
- 是无法连接网络或签名失败?
不同“找不到”对应不同根因:应用层、链路层、账户层、合约层。
2)建议的排查顺序(由易到难)
- 网络层:切换网络(Wi-Fi/移动数据/VPN),检查DNS与时间是否正确。
- 客户端层:更新到最新版本;清缓存/重启;检查权限(网络、存储、通知)。
- 账户层:确认助记词/私钥导入是否为同一链环境;检查导入路径与地址是否一致。
- 交互层:若涉及DApp连接,检查授权合约是否被撤销、链ID是否匹配、Gas是否足够。
- 安全层:排查是否安装了同名仿冒版本或浏览器插件篡改页面。
3)最常见的“表面找不到”成因
- 区域/商店分发差异:某些地区应用可见性不同。
- 链切换导致地址余额“看似消失”:例如切错网络、代币合约地址不在该链。
- 旧版本缓存:列表、代币元数据更新滞后。
- 网络阻断:DNS污染、运营商劫持、跨境链路质量差。
- 恶意脚本/插件:通过注入篡改RPC、拦截签名请求。
二、防代码注入:把安全前置到“可疑输入之前”
“找不到”有时是系统被攻击后的表现之一。尤其是移动端与浏览器端的交互,恶意代码可能不会直接“让你找不到”,而是把你带到错误地址、错误RPC或伪造的界面。
1)典型注入路径
- DApp页面脚本注入:劫持provider或重写签名回调。
- 浏览器插件/系统代理:替换API请求,返回伪造数据。
- 恶意合约交互引导:诱导你在错误网络或错误合约上签名。
2)防护策略(面向用户与产品)
- 来源校验:只从官方渠道下载;核对包名/签名指纹。
- 最小权限:授权交易前确认合约地址、链ID、代币合约与权限范围。
- 本地签名隔离:私钥或敏感操作尽量不暴露给可疑网页环境。
- 风险提示机制:出现异常RPC、异常参数、异常链ID时强制二次确认。
- 输入净化与参数白名单:把“合约地址/链ID/路由参数”做格式校验,拒绝可疑注入载荷。
三、全球化数字化趋势:钱包体验会随区域与监管演进而变化
全球化数字化的主线是“跨境资产与跨链交互”常态化,而“钱包找不到”往往是跨区域分发、跨链兼容与监管合规之间的摩擦点。
1)趋势如何影响“可见性”与“可用性”
- 应用分发:不同地区的应用商店审核与可见性策略不同。
- 跨境网络:延迟、丢包、DNS差异会影响RPC连通与数据同步速度。
- 合规要求:某些地区的服务接口或合作方能力会不同。
2)行业应对方向
- 多通道接入:提供多RPC/多数据源,降低单点故障。
- 透明链上状态:尽量让用户看到“为何加载失败”,而不是仅显示“找不到”。
- 更强的本地化与多语言可读错误码:让用户能按提示恢复或切换网络。
四、行业动向预测:从“钱包”到“账户与数据层”的升级
接下来的竞争重点可能不在“谁先做出钱包界面”,而在:
- 账户体验(余额/交易/权限可解释)
- 数据可信(元数据与价格来源可追溯)
- 安全可验证(签名与授权流程更清晰)
- 架构更轻量(适配弱网与低资源设备)
1)预测一:错误提示将更标准化
未来钱包产品会更强调可观测性:RPC状态、链ID、代币元数据版本、授权状态的“结构化错误码”。
2)预测二:更多“轻节点/轻验证”方案
减少全量同步依赖,提高弱网环境下的可用性。

3)预测三:安全从“事后追责”转向“事中拦截”
例如对签名请求进行风险评分:目标合约是否可疑、交易权限是否过宽、参数是否异常。
五、数据化商业模式:钱包不仅是工具,也是数据入口
“数据化商业模式”意味着:围绕用户链上行为、资产结构、交互偏好形成数据服务能力。但这也要求更严格的隐私与密码保密。
1)可能的数据化方向(合规前提下)
- 资产与交易的可解释聚合:让用户看到资产来源、收益来源与风险暴露。
- 个性化提醒:例如Gas变化、代币价格预警、授权过期提醒。
- 交互路线优化:为DApp提供更低失败率的路由与更快的数据回填。
2)关键约束:避免隐私泄露与过度收集
- 最小化采集:仅收集完成功能所需的匿名或脱敏数据。
- 端侧优先:能在本地处理的尽量本地处理。
- 风险分级:对敏感操作(签名、导入、撤权)保持更高安全门槛。
六、轻节点:提高可用性与鲁棒性,缓解“找不到”的体验落差
轻节点(轻验证/轻同步)通常指不依赖完整链数据或减少本地存储与同步压力,让客户端在资源受限或网络不稳定时仍能工作。
1)为什么轻节点会改善“找不到”
- 弱网下更快完成状态校验与账户展示。
- 降低因全量同步失败导致的功能不可用。
- 更容易进行多源校验:当某一数据源异常时可快速切换。
2)对安全与可信的影响
轻节点更依赖验证与证明机制;因此需要更严格的:
- 结果校验(状态根/默克尔证明等思想的实现)
- 数据源可信度管理(多源交叉验证)
- 对异常数据源的自动降级与告警
七、密码保密:把“无法被看见”当成安全体系的底座
钱包安全的核心并不在“你知道多少”,而在“敏感信息是否会在系统链路上暴露”。
1)密码保密的关键点
- 助记词/私钥不进入不可信环境:不要让网页脚本触达敏感材料。
- 内存与本地存储安全:必要时使用系统安全存储(如Keychain/Keystore)。
- 传输加密与完整性保护:避免中间人篡改交易参数或返回数据。
2)即便遇到“找不到”,也要优先保障保密
- 不要为了“快速恢复”而在不可靠渠道输入助记词。
- 不要在来路不明页面点击“自动导入/一键恢复”。
- 任何“看起来能帮你修复”的脚本都应先在本地评估风险。
八、把以上内容落到行动:用户与开发者的双向清单
1)用户行动清单
- 确认版本与来源:只用官方安装渠道。
- 检查网络与链ID:确保你在正确链上查看资产。
- 检查授权与插件:撤销异常权限,禁用可疑插件。

- 使用多环境验证:同一地址在不同设备/不同网络上是否一致。
- 避免敏感信息外泄:不要在非官方页面输入助记词/私钥。
2)开发者行动清单
- 错误可观测:结构化错误码 + 可读排查指引。
- 强化注入防护:provider隔离、参数白名单、签名前风险提示。
- 轻节点与多源策略:弱网下仍能展示关键信息并校验结果。
- 数据化合规:端侧优先、脱敏、最小化与透明告知。
- 密码保密体系:安全存储、加密传输、敏感操作隔离。
九、总结:从“找不到”到“可解释、可恢复、可验证”
当TPWallet找不到时,建议不要只停留在“重装/换版本”,而是从安全(防代码注入、密码保密)、架构(轻节点与可验证数据)、以及趋势(全球化数字化、数据化商业模式、行业动向预测)建立系统视角。最终目标不是让问题消失,而是让用户在出现异常时:知道发生了什么、如何安全恢复、以及如何在未来更不容易被错误数据或恶意注入影响。
评论
MiaWang
信息很全面,尤其把“找不到”的原因按层次拆开,排查会更快。
ArtemisZH
防代码注入这一段对钱包类应用很关键,签名风险提示的思路很实用。
小舟不问
轻节点与多源校验解释得通透;弱网环境下确实更容易提升可用性。
NovaKaito
数据化商业模式那部分提醒了隐私与合规约束,不然容易越做越不可信。
SoraLi
密码保密强调“敏感材料不进不可信环境”很对,尤其不要在网页里乱输入助记词。